#897652 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#897652 is composed of 53.7% red, 46.3%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 40.1%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 39.3 degrees, a saturation of 25.1% and a lightness of 42.9%. #897652 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eca4 with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#897652

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f9f7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#897652

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706e6b is the less saturated color, while #d58d06 is the most saturated one.
